The aim of the study is to forecast scientific support for the advancement of the digital economy in the world and Ukraine. A methodological approach for forecasting scientific support for the advancement of the digital economy, based on bibliometric and patent analysis, is proposed. The main task of the analysis is to compare scientific developments which contribute to the advancement of the digital economy in Ukraine with those in other countries in the world. The forecast results indicate the upward trend in the volume of patents and scientific publications which ensure the advancement of the digital economy in the world in the coming years. It is revealed that, if the current situation persists, the share of Ukraine in the global number of patents and publications will remain extremely low. The forecast demonstrates that the inequality in the level of scientific support for the advancement of the digital economy between leading countries of the world and Ukraine will increase in the near future if immediate measures to stimulate own researches in the field of digital technologies are not taken at the state level.

Digital technologies, ubiquitous in our daily life, have radically changed the way we work, communicate, and consume in a short period of time. They affect all components of quality of life: well-being, work, health, education, social connections, environmental quality, the ability to participate and govern civil society, and so on. Digital transformation creates both opportunities and serious risks to the well-being of people. Researchers and statistical agencies around the world are facing a major challenge to develop new tools to analyze the impact of digital transformation on the well-being of the population. The risks are very diverse in nature and it is very difficult to identify the key factor. All researchers conclude that secure digital technologies significantly improve the lives of those who have the skills to use them and pose a serious risk of inequality for society, as they introduce a digital divide between those who have the skills to use them and those who do not. In the article, the author examines the risks created by digital technologies for some components of the quality of life (digital component of the quality of life), which are six main components: the digital quality of the population, providing the population with digital benefits, the labor market in the digital economy, the impact of digitalization on the social sphere, state electronic services for the population and the security of information activities. The study was carried out on the basis of the available statistical base and the results of research by scientists from different countries of the world. The risks of the digital economy cannot be ignored when pursuing state social policy. Attention is paid to government regulation aimed at reducing the negative consequences of digitalization through the prism of national, federal projects and other events.

The article is concerned with the topical issues of present – the principles and foundations of introduction of circular economy (CE). The article emphasizes that, despite the fact that the issue of introducing circular economy has already been widely covered in the scientific publications by domestic and foreign scholars, any strategy for the practical introduction of circular economy at the State level has not yet been formed. Thus, the publication is aimed at studying the key aspects and prerequisites for the introduction of circular economy within the Ukrainian terms. In accordance with this aim, the advantages and disadvantages of the introduction of circular economy in the world aspect are analyzed. The advantages of the introduction of circular economy include the following issues: profitability growth; reduction of greenhouse gas emissions; creation of new jobs. Among the shortcomings of the introduction of circular economy, the publication distinguishes the following: level of complexity of the promotion of systemic changes; economic fluctuations (CE may be non-profit in a short period of time); unsuitable markets (lack of necessary raw materials and infrastructure, competition, knowledge); imperfect regulation (imperfect legislation and/or its implementing); social factors (lack of knowledge and skills related to circular economy); insufficient control over waste sorting; level of financing (both on the part of the State treasury and business). Summing up the advantages and disadvantages of the introduction of circular economy, it is emphasized that, in the terms of CE, the most important value is not being attached to material flows or waste, but to much more sufficient methods, such as maintenance, reuse and recycling of equipment. Also, the research pays considerable attention to the instruments of circular economy and the prerequisites for their application. In addition, each of the above mentioned instruments is considered in the aspect of practical use and analyzed upon existing in the world examples. Thus, among the instruments for the introduction of circular economy, the author highlights: Design of thinking of the future; Virtualization and sharing; Product as a service; Reuse in production; Reuse in consumption; Industrial symbiousness and processing of production waste; Recycling. Special attention in the article is given to the problems of introducing circular economy in Ukraine and ways to solve them. Thus, the research has consistently revealed the problems and ways to solve them at the level of government, business, and society.

The digital economy can lead to an increase in the inequality between advanced countries and developing ones, which cannot keep pace with changes in the modern world. Nations that want to be competitive in the future need to develop digital technologies using their own scientific potential. The complexity, multidimensionality, and ill-structuredeness of problems related to adaptation of countries to the digitalization of the economy require using the cognitive approach. The aim of the article is to study the development of science under conditions of countries’ adapting to the digitalization of the economy with the use of the cognitive approach. A methodological approach to studying problems of development of science under conditions of adapting to the digitalization of the economy is proposed. In accordance with the methodological approach, a cognitive model for studying problems of development of science under conditions of a country’s adapting to the digitalization of the economy is built. The presented model for studying problems of development of science in Ukraine under conditions of adapting to the digitalization of the economy reveals risks and helps identify opportunities for reforming the scientific sphere.
